United States Precision Casting Parts Market by Applications

Precision casting, also known as investment casting or lost-wax casting, plays a crucial role in various industries across United States. This advanced manufacturing process involves the production of intricate components with high dimensional accuracy and excellent surface finish. The applications of precision casting parts in United States span diverse sectors, each benefiting from the precision and reliability offered by this technology.

The aerospace industry in United States extensively utilizes precision casting parts for manufacturing critical components such as turbine blades, engine components, and structural parts. The ability of precision casting to produce complex shapes with tight tolerances and superior surface quality is particularly advantageous in aerospace applications where performance, reliability, and weight reduction are paramount.

In the automotive sector, precision casting parts are integral to enhancing vehicle performance, efficiency, and safety. Engine parts, transmission components, and chassis parts benefit from the high strength-to-weight ratio and design flexibility offered by precision casting. United Statesn automakers rely on these parts to improve fuel efficiency, reduce emissions, and achieve superior vehicle dynamics.

The healthcare industry in United States leverages precision casting parts for manufacturing medical devices and equipment. Components such as implants, surgical instruments, and diagnostic equipment require precise dimensions, biocompatibility, and durability, all of which can be achieved through precision casting. This technology ensures that medical devices meet stringent regulatory standards and contribute to advancements in healthcare delivery.

United States’s energy sector utilizes precision casting parts in applications ranging from power generation to oil and gas exploration. Turbomachinery components, valves, and pump parts benefit from the high reliability, corrosion resistance, and performance optimization provided by precision casting. These parts contribute to the efficiency and sustainability of energy production processes across the continent.
